knowing then what u know now

Hi again,
I've done a lot of research on agencies-adoption process. (Thanks to the individuals who responded about the agencies). But, there is always information that is gained by going through the experience that is priceless.

If anyone has some "pearls of wisdom" about international adoption-kinda like if I had know this before it would have been helpful-I would appreciate it tremendously. Thanks.

Pearls

Pick 2 countries that you are interested in, and make sure your agency does both. Countries often close, and you may be forced to switch. You will not want to change agencies if this happens.

Also, shop around for homesudy agencies. They are not all created equal. Some take 3 months, and require extensive peperwork, others take 1 month and require very little.

I would apply for my 171 MUCH sooner, I would also not do electronic fingerprints, it seems that people who had standard prints that they were able to mail in envelopes stating that it was "for an adoption immediate attention required" got their background checks processed much quicker.
Our only frustrations have been in waiting for other organizations to process paperwork, so I would just apply some of these little "tricks" to help speed things along.

Talking Get photocopies...

of ABSOLUTELY everything.

Just in case.

Our lawyer already has all the originals, and mistakenly, I forgot to copy them.

Now I need copies for my new adoption agency, and will have to get them all copied and sent back...

Stupid, but at least I know better now!
